Police have arrested two more people involved in the violent pro-monarchy protest that took place in Tinkune.
The arrested are 45-year-old Dil Kumar Shrestha from Arun Rural Municipality-5, Bhojpur, and 30-year-old Jit Bahadur Shrestha from Lisankhu Pakhar Rural Municipality-4, Sindhupalchok.
The Kathmandu District Court has extended their custody by 20 days under charges of criminal violence and organized crime.
With these arrests, the total number of people detained in connection to the incident has reached 75.
The protest, led by Durga Prasai on Chaitra 15, had turned violent, resulting in the deaths of two people and incidents of vandalism, arson, and looting of private property.
